Abstract

The invention discloses a multi-channel current multiplexing chopper amplifier, which includes a plurality of amplifier units; the amplifier unit includes sequentially connected differential input terminals, a first chopping switch, an input-stage amplifying circuit, a second chopping switch and An output stage amplifying circuit, and a feedback loop for feeding back a signal of the output stage amplifying circuit to the input stage amplifying circuit, the feedback loop includes a feedback chopping switch and a feedback capacitor; at the first chopping switch and the input stage amplifying circuit An input capacitor is provided between them; an isolation capacitor is provided between the input stage amplifying circuit and the second chopper switch, and a bias resistor is provided at the input end of the output stage amplifying circuit; the input stages of the adjacent two amplifier units The amplifying circuits are stacked and connected, and all amplifier units share one current source. The input stage amplifying circuit of the present invention shares one current source, which simplifies the complexity of the circuit and reduces the area and power consumption of the integrated circuit. The invention can be widely used in the field of integrated circuits.

technical field [0001] The invention relates to the field of integrated circuits, in particular to a multi-channel current multiplexing chopper amplifier and a chip. Background technique [0002] The acquisition of low-frequency weak signals, especially the acquisition of biomedical signals, usually has specific requirements for the front-end amplifier circuit. In the low frequency band, the flicker noise is more significant, so it is usually necessary to chop the signal to be amplified to filter out the low frequency noise. In addition, for the implantable multi-channel biomedical signal acquisition system, the front-end amplifier circuit is also required to have the characteristics of low power consumption and small area. [0003] In the prior art, the orthogonal current multiplexing technology is a way to realize multi-channel weak signal acquisition with low power consumption.
